Cancer Gene Therapy Market Poised for Significant Growth, Projected to Reach USD 3,142.2 Million by 2034 at a 5.6% of CAGR
The global market for cancer gene therapy is expected to see substantial growth in the coming decade. Estimated at USD 1,822.2 million in 2024, the market is forecast to expand to USD 3,142.2 million by 2034, growing at a compound annual growth rate (CAGR) of 5.6%. This growth is driven by increasing demand for more targeted and personalized cancer treatments, as well as advancements in genetic therapies. Notably, oncolytic virotherapy, which generated USD 850.7 million in 2023, is emerging as a key contributor to this market expansion.
The cancer gene therapy market is largely fueled by the growing shift toward personalized medicines. Unlike traditional treatments like chemotherapy and radiation, which are broad and less precise, gene therapy targets the genetic mutations responsible for cancer's development. This tailored approach minimizes damage to healthy cells, reducing side effects and enhancing the efficacy of treatment. The increased focus on targeted therapies and drugs further supports this trend, with gene therapy offering new hope for patients by addressing cancer at its genetic root.
The rising global prevalence of cancer, coupled with increased investment in clinical trials and research, has accelerated the development of gene therapies. Financial investments in clinical-phase gene therapy research are intensifying, with a surge in clinical trial protocols moving through Phase I, II, and III towards regulatory approval. This boost in research and development is laying the groundwork for future innovations in gene therapies and expanding treatment options for cancer patients worldwide.
Key players in the gene therapy manufacturing industry are also investing in new technologies to streamline production and delivery. These investments, combined with the rapid pace of regulatory approvals, are catalyzing interest in gene therapies for cancer. As clinical trials continue to demonstrate the potential of these therapies, the cancer gene therapy market is poised for significant growth, offering promising treatment alternatives for patients and driving the next wave of cancer care innovation.

Key Drivers of Market Growth
Increased Demand for Personalized Medicine: The shift towards personalized treatment options is a significant factor driving the growth of the cancer gene therapy market. Gene therapy specifically targets the genetic alterations responsible for cancer, offering a more tailored approach compared to traditional therapies like chemotherapy and radiation, which can affect healthy cells and lead to higher toxicity and side effects.
Rising Global Cancer Incidence: The increasing prevalence of cancer worldwide is propelling demand for innovative treatment solutions, including gene therapy. As cancer cases rise, the need for effective therapies that can address the complexities of the disease becomes critical.
Advancements in Research and Development: There has been a notable increase in financial investments in clinical research focused on gene therapy. This has led to a rapid expansion of clinical trial protocols across various phases (I, II, and III), facilitating the path to regulatory approvals and market entry for new therapies.
Technological Innovations: Continuous advancements in gene therapy techniques and delivery methods are enhancing the efficacy of treatments. Innovations such as improved vectors for gene delivery and novel therapeutic approaches are attracting interest from both researchers and healthcare providers.

Recent Industry Developments in Cancer Gene Therapy Market
In June 2021, Eisai and Bristol Myers Squibb agreed to collaborate on the development and commercialization of Eisai's ADC, MORAb-202, for advanced solid malignancies.
In June 2021, GSK and iTeos Therapeutics collaborated to develop EOS-448, an anti-TIGIT monoclonal antibody that had previously been approved in phase 1 for advanced solid malignancies.
